By means of the valve body rotatably arranged in the transfer cap, a connection can be established between the hollow mandrel attached to the transfer cap, which is inserted into the sealing area of an infusion container, and the angled tubular piece. At the exposed end of this pipe piece, contamination may occur during the handling of the device.

After connecting the infusion container to the medicament container, infusion solution is first forced into the medicament container by repeatedly compressing the flexible infusion container. After dissolving and mixing the drug for solution for infusion, the assembly is rotated so that the infusion container at the bottom and the drug container is at the top, whereupon the contents of the drug container is sucked back into the infusion container by this again compressed and released several times. Thereafter, the drug container with transfer cap is removed from the infusion container and the infusion set attached to the infusion container, whereupon the infusion can begin.

By not releasing the medicament container from the transfer cap after admixing the infusion solution drug and performing the infusion while the medicament container is in the infusion container, the system is kept closed to avoid the risk of contamination of the infusion solution.

Fig. 1 shows a bottle-shaped infusion container 1, which usually consists of transparent plastic and flexible wall sections, so that the infusion container 1 can be compressed to generate a pressure in the container, whereupon by releasing a negative pressure is generated by the elastic side walls Reset. With 1.1 an eye for hanging the infusion container is called. On the lower side in the operating position of the infusion container is provided with a bottleneck 1.2, on which a transfer cap 2 is attached. 3 is a medicament container, usually a glass bottle, which is inserted with its axis oblique to the axis of the infusion container 1 in the transfer cap 2. 4 is a drip chamber of an infusion set, which is connected to the infusion container 1. Fig. 1 shows the operating position of the device in which an infusion is carried out, wherein the drip chamber 4 is arranged with its axis substantially parallel to the axis of the infusion container 1 or perpendicular and not oblique.

Fig. 2 shows in a section a first embodiment of the transfer cap 2 in the in Fig. 1 reproduced operating position. On the neck 1.2 of the infusion container 1, a sealing cap 1.3 is attached fluid-tight, which is provided with a pierceable seal area 1.4. On the bottleneck 1.2 with sealing cap 1.3, the transfer cap 2 via elastic latching sections 2.1 on a flange ( Fig. 1 ), which do not detachably overlap the edge of the sealing cap 1.3 without tools. To the in Fig. 2 Placed overhead flange with the catches 2.1 is followed by a substantially hollow cylindrical section 2.2 of the transfer cap, on the underside in Fig. 2 eccentrically a tubular approach 2.3 is formed so that its axis B is oblique to the axis A of the bottle neck 1.2 on the infusion container 1. This tubular approach 2.3 forms a receiving device for the drug container 3, which engages with its bottleneck 3.1 in this tubular approach 2.3. The tubular extension 2.3 is provided on its circumference with elastic hooks or notches 2.31, so that the provided with a flange or a crimp cap 3.1 of the medicine container 3 can engage in the tubular extension 2.3, whereupon the notches 2.31 the drug container 3 in the connecting position lock.

In this case, the transfer cap 2 is connected to the medicament container 3 such that it can not be detached from the transfer cap 2 without a tool. Thereafter, the transfer cap 2 is attached to the sealed infusion container 1 with medicine container 3, so that the hollow mandrel 2.4 penetrates the seal area 1.4, as this Fig. 2a shows. In this case, the infusion container 1 may be positioned with the bottle neck on the top, so that the transfer cap 2 and the medicament container 3 are attached to the infusion container 1 from above. The closed valve 5 prevents it from leaking out of the medicament container 3.

By the force exerted on the infusion container 1 pressure, the valve disc 5 opens by bending between the slots 5.1 elastic valve lugs bend and allow a passage of infusion liquid to the drug container 3. After dissolution and mixing of the drug in the drug container 3, the arrangement is again rotated 180 ° in the in Fig. 2b rotated position reproduced, whereupon by repeated compression of the infusion container 1, the infusion solution admixed drug from the drug container 3 is sucked into the infusion container 1. In this case, the valve disc 5 opens by the negative pressure generated in the infusion container 1 after releasing the compressed side walls of the infusion container. 1

Here, the connection between the drug container 3 and infusion container 1 is interrupted by the valve disc 5, because no forces acting on the valve disc 5. It can thus flow back no infusion solution in the underlying drug container 3. The medicine container 3 is not detachably connected to the transfer cap 2 and remains in the in Fig. 1 and 2 reproduced position on the transfer cap 2, as long as the infusion is performed.

Because the medicament container 3 is not released from the infusion container 1 or the transfer cap 2 after the mixing process, contamination in the connection area between the medicament container 3 and the infusion container 1 can not occur. After attaching the medicine container 3, the system remains closed.

Fig. 3 shows a second embodiment with an actuatable by turning valve, wherein on the hollow mandrel 2.5, a valve disc 6 is formed, which is rotatably supported between detents on the partition wall 2.7 of the transfer cap 2 and eccentrically provided with a passage opening 6.1, with the mouth opening of the hollow dome 2.4 can be aligned. Fig. 3 shows the closed position of the valve disc 6, in which a closed area of the valve disc 6 of the mouth opening of the hollow dome 2.4 is opposite. Fig. 3a shows the connection position of the valve disc 6, in which the passage opening 6.1 is aligned with the hollow dome 2.4.

Fig. 4 shows a third embodiment with a displaceable in the axial direction of the tubular extension 2.3 valve element 7. In this embodiment, a neck 2.51 is formed on the hollow dome 2.5, which has a passage 2.52 ( Fig. 4a ), which can be closed and released by the displaceable valve element 7. Fig. 4 shows the closed position and the Fig. 4a the open position in which the sleeve-shaped valve element 7 is displaced in the direction of the medicament container 3, so that the passageway 2.52 is released.

Fig. 5 shows a fourth embodiment of the valve between the obliquely arranged hollow mandrels 2.4 and 2.5 in the transfer cap 2, which has a rotatable valve body 8 with a protruding on the transfer cap 2 knob 8.1. The shaft-shaped valve body 8 is rotatable in a transverse bore of a lug on the hollow mandrel 2.5 and provided with a passage opening 8.2, which can be aligned with the hollow mandrel 2.5 and a connection opening to the hollow mandrel 2.4, when the knob 8.1 is rotated in the marked by a mark 8.11 open position , Fig. 5a shows the open position.

  1. Device for adding a medicine to an infusion solution in an infusion container (1), whose removal opening is provided with a seal area (1 4), comprising a cylindrical transfer cap (2),
    which can be connected to the removal opening of the infusion container (1) and has a hollow spike (24) for piercing the seal area (1.4),
    wherein a hollow cylindrical receiving means (2 3) for a medicine container (3) is formed at the cylindrical transfer cap (2) and has a hollow spike (2.5) for piercing a seal (3 2) at the medicine container (3),
    a valve (5; 6; 7; 8) arranged between the two hollow spikes (2.4, 2.5) in the transfer cap (2),
    wherein the valve interrupts the connection between the two hollow spikes (2 4, 2.5) and can be moved into the open position only by the action of a force, and
    wherein a free area (2.6) is formed at the transfer cap (2) for attaching an infusion set, characterized in that
    the hollow cylindrical receiving means (2 3) is arranged excentrically at the cylindrical transfer cap (2), wherein laterally adjacent the excentrically arranged hollow cylindrical receiving means (2.3), a recess (2 6) is formed at the transfer cap, into which the infusion set with a hollow spike (4.1) can be inserted by piercing vertically into the seal area (1 4) of the infusion container
  2. Device according to claim 1, wherein the hollow cylindrical receiving means (2 3) is positioned with its axis (B) inclined to the axis (A) of the transfer cap (2), such that a medicine container (3) inserted in the receiving means (2.3) is arranged inclined to the axis (A) of the receiving means (2 3)
  3. Device according to claim 1 or 2, wherein the receiving means (2 3) for the medicine container (3) has a non-releasable connecting means
  4. Device according to one of claims 1 to 3, wherein the transfer cap (2) is formed in two parts and has a tubular hub (2.3) as a receiving means for the medicine container (3) and a hollow cylindrical portion (2.2) which via a locking means (2.32, 2.33) can be connected to the tubular hub (2.3) at which the hollow spike (2.5) is moulded on
  5. Device according to one of the preceding claims, wherein the valve is formed as a resilient valve disc (5) between the hollow spikes (2.4, 2.5) and provided with at least one slit which can be opened by pressure or low pressure
  6. Device according to one of claims 1 to 4, wherein the valve has a rotatable valve disc (6) which is provided with a passage opening (6 1), which by rotating can be aligned with the hollow spikes (2.4, 2.5) located opposite each other.
  7. Device according to one of claims 1 to 4, wherein the valve has a member (7) which is displaceable in the axial direction of the connection between the hollow spikes (2.4, 2.5) and by means of which a through-channel (2.52) can be sealed and unblocked
  8. Device according to one of claims 1 to 4, wherein the valve has a valve body (8) having a passage opening, the valve body being rotatable by an adjusting knob (8.1) and being arranged between the hollow spikes (2 4, 2 5) located opposite each other in the transfer cap (2).
  9. Device according to one of claims 1 to 3 and 5 to 8, wherein the hollow spike (2.5) provided for the medicine container (3) is inserted into the transfer cap (2) as a separate component part.
  10. Device according to claim 9, wherein at least members of the valve are moulded on or attached at the hollow spike (2.5)
